Description

A geophysical survey was conducted on land to the west of South Witham Quarry to inform a proposed quarry extension. This followed an earlier, more limited, phase of geophysical survey (ELI8392) and subsequent trial trenching (ELI14559). The survey revealed that a series of Middle to Late Iron Age ditches encountered by the trial trenching at the western edge of site formed part of a wider enclosure system. A continuation of the trackway identified by both the earlier geophysical survey and trial trenching was also recorded. Anomalies representing probable Medieval ridge and furrow were also noted in the western half of the site. {1}
